What happens if you run out of cards in smash up?

If Your Deck Runs Out of Cards If you need to draw, reveal, search for, or look at a card and your deck is empty, shuffle your discard pile and put it on the table face down--that's your new deck. Start drawing from there. This rule applies at all times of the game, not just this phase.

What happens when you tie in Smash Up?

If players are tied on a base, all involved players get points for the best position they tied for. So, if three players had 10, 10, and 5 power on a base when it scores, the winners with 10 power each get first place points!

Can you discard cards in Smash Up?

Discard: When a card gets discarded, it goes to the discard pile of the player whose deck it came from, no matter who played or controlled it. Destroy: When a card says to destroy another card, put the destroyed card in its owner's discard pile.

How many Smash Up cards are there?

As of the Smash Up Teens promo release, there are 100 factions, which can combine to form 4,950 unique pairs of factions. Every faction is composed of a 20-card deck and each player shuffles two factions together to form their deck of 40 cards.

What does bury mean in Smash Up?

Burying happens when a card tells you to "bury" a card. Burying a card is simply placing a card face-down on a base, with its controller being the only player who can see what it is. When a card is turned face-up, this is called "uncovering" the card and that's when its ability is resolved.

How do duels work in Smash Up?

Duels are started by card abilities through the "duel" keyword and when it happens, two minions face off, the minion with the higher power winning the duel for its controller. However, their respective controllers have the opportunity to play one action in order to change the outcome.
